Lochinvar WHN085

MikeJ
MikeJ Member Posts: 103
I'm an HVAC contractor -Steamfitter, put in a lot of Lochinvar boilers. Never any problems.
Had one sitting in the basement for 4 years.
Just put it in my house took out he muchkin boiler

Having problems, The first fault was going off on Outlet Sensor Fault, made sure no air in the system, Check sensor resistance
they check good, put in a new module (made sense) wrong!

Now getting Delta T high, again checked pumps, checked for air, ohm out sensors.

Now I notice before the boiler even lights my delta T reading is jumping all over the place, 6 to 35 to 12 to 20 -4 yes negative 4
Then the boiler lights within a couple secs, delta T jumps up out of range and locks out the boiler,

I already assume the module, we all know what assume means smiley:

Thanks for any help you may have

MIke

    I am not sure if it uses the same sensor as the KHN, but they had problems with the temperature sensor on some of them. It is a four wire, duel sensor on the upper part of the tank. Apparently the wires did not get seated right in the manufacturing process and can get loose. I would look at changing that out.

    Definitely sounds like the sensor. There are two thermistors in it and if they read more than 20* difference between them, the module will lock out on that code. We've seen the same issue.

    Scratched my head on that sensor (s) molex for a bit. Why they word it as a delta t difference, when the 2 sensors are in the same water, and the same molex. Just must be their way of determining that their main sensor has failed, because the 2 can't agree on the same temp.

    The Outlet Sensor failed on my WHN110 two years ago after having been in service for two years. Luckily I had a spare handy and I now keep TWO spares in the Lochinvar parts drawer.

    Not the best picture of the Knight display indicating the Lockout Condition but if you look closely...



    A rather interesting way (two thermistors in one sensor) of validating results for a mission-critical parameter. They do the same thing on the Flue Gas sensor.
